PSSH, kør kommandoer på flere eksterne servere samtidigt

pssh

OpenSSH er et af de mest anvendte værktøjer af systemadministratorer, og det er logisk, at dette er tilfældet, da det giver os mulighed for at interagere med enhver computer eksternt, men som om vi sad lige der, og vi har endda gennem X11 Videresendelse, evnen til at se enhver GUI. Men der er en logisk begrænsning, og det er, at vi har brug for at åbne en forbindelse til hver fjerncomputer, som vi har adgang til, og som vi har brug for så mange terminalvinduer.

Men gratis software har altid overraskelser for os, og der er et værktøj som PSSH det tillader os kør kommandoer via SSH på flere eksterne servere fra en enkelt shellog sparer således ressourcer og vinder meget agility, når de håndteres. Det er et meget interessant projekt, der er udviklet i Python, og som tilbyder en meget intelligent og enkel operation for dem af os, der allerede har brugt SSH regelmæssigt.

Er det PSSH består af forskellige værktøjer, som tilbyder os komplet funktionalitet, når det kommer til styring af eksterne servere, da vi har et program som pscp til at kopiere filer til flere værter parallelt, prsync til at synkronisere filer til flere værter samtidigt, pnuke for at afslutte eller 'dræbe' processer på flere værter og pslurp for at kopiere filer fra flere fjernværter til en maskine. Som vi kan se, er de muligheder, som de alle tilbyder os imponerende, siden vi kan udføre en samtidig sikkerhedskopiering til to computere, blandt andet.

PSSH kan installeres, hvis vi downloader og installerer Pip i vores distro; For dem, der ikke kender dette værktøj, kan vi sige, at det er en kommando, der letter installation og styring af Python-baseret software. Når vi har installeret det (det er i de officielle opbevaringssteder i de vigtigste distroer, det kaldes python-pip) gør vi noget så simpelt som:

# pip installer pssh

Dette værktøj vil gøre sit, og det vil vi have PSSH installeret, så er det tid til at konfigurere værtsfilen, som ikke findes, og vi bliver nødt til at oprette den for at tilføje IP-adressen til de værter, som vi vil få adgang til. Vi kan lære mere ved at køre 'pssh –help', men det kan vi med sikkerhed sige Parallel SSH eller PSSH Det er et meget komplet og alsidigt værktøj, hvis funktionalitet kan være, hvad mange SysAdmins ventede på.

Yderligere oplysninger: PSSH (i Google-kode)


Efterlad din kommentar

Din e-mailadresse vil ikke blive offentliggjort. Obligatoriske felter er markeret med *

*

*

  1. Ansvarlig for data: AB Internet Networks 2008 SL
  2. Formålet med dataene: Control SPAM, management af kommentarer.
  3. Legitimering: Dit samtykke
  4. Kommunikation af dataene: Dataene vil ikke blive kommunikeret til tredjemand, undtagen ved juridisk forpligtelse.
  5. Datalagring: Database hostet af Occentus Networks (EU)
  6. Rettigheder: Du kan til enhver tid begrænse, gendanne og slette dine oplysninger.

  1.   Fernando sagde han

    Interessant! at omsætte det i praksis